Understanding Power Efficiency in Motherboards

Power efficiency in motherboards depends on several factors including component design, power delivery systems, and integrated features. Efficient motherboards help reduce energy costs and extend the lifespan of components by minimizing excess heat and power waste.

Power Consumption Testing and Results

Testing the power efficiency involves measuring the motherboard’s energy use during idle and under load conditions. The Asus Rog Strix B650E-E demonstrates low idle power consumption thanks to its energy-saving features. Under load, it maintains stable power delivery while minimizing excess energy use.

Idle State

During idle, the motherboard consumes approximately 15-20 watts, which is typical for modern high-performance motherboards. This low power draw is aided by the motherboard’s efficient power phases and BIOS optimizations.

Under Load

During intensive tasks such as gaming or rendering, power consumption increases but remains within an efficient range of 70-100 watts. The VRM design ensures stable power delivery, reducing energy waste and heat generation.
